About American House Somerset
American House Somerset in Troy, Michigan, distinguishes itself with a certified memory care team and a broad spectrum of amenities tailored to enrich residents’ daily lives. Spacious private apartments, including studios and one-bedroom options, feature safety-conscious designs and familiar furnishings that promote comfort and independence. The community’s attentive staff demonstrate deep knowledge of residents’ preferences, ensuring personalized dining and care. Residents engage in diverse activities such as cooking classes, outings, and wellness programs, supported by beautifully maintained grounds with walking paths and a putting green. With 24-hour nursing care and a focus on quality of life, American House Somerset blends medical support with social engagement in a welcoming setting.

My wife and I visited a family member at this American house location recently. We signed in when we walked in and went to my family members room. I’ll refer to the family member as FM. My FM’s room was very nice and had a small kitchen with no stove, I’m sure for safety reasons. The room had a really high ceiling, so it was very airy and seemed larger than it was, however there was plenty of room for one person. The room was furnished with the furniture from my FM’s house which was nice because it was very familiar to them. In the short time we were in the room talking to my FM, three different staff members came in to see how my FM was doing. We accompanied my FM to dinner and when the order was placed, the staff whispered to us and said your FM will not eat what they ordered and they recommended we switch it to something else, so we did. My FM ate what was ordered and enjoyed it, so that tells me the staff are really paying attention and know what they will eat and not eat. I really liked this place and their staff. Everyone we interacted with was nice, friendly, were smiling and seemed happy to be there. The facility is very clean and we have no complaints about the staff or the facility.

Value Consideration
Pricing ranges from $4,940 to $7,490 monthly, above the local average, reflecting the community’s extensive amenities and specialized memory care. While many find value in the quality of care and services, some families feel the cost is not justified given occasional staffing and care concerns.
